What Is ChatGPT?

ChatGPT is an advanced conversational AI assistant developed by OpenAI that uses large language models (LLMs) to engage in natural, human-like conversations. Launched in November 2022, ChatGPT quickly became the fastest-growing consumer application in history, reaching 100 million users within two months. The system can understand context, generate creative content, answer questions, assist with coding, analyze documents, and perform a wide variety of language-based tasks through simple text prompts.

ChatGPT represents a significant evolution in human-computer interaction, moving beyond traditional keyword-based systems to truly conversational interfaces. The assistant leverages the GPT (Generative Pre-trained Transformer) architecture, specifically designed to predict and generate coherent, contextually appropriate text. Unlike rule-based chatbots that follow predetermined scripts, ChatGPT uses probabilistic language modeling to generate responses dynamically, enabling it to handle open-ended questions, creative tasks, and complex reasoning across virtually unlimited topics.

The current ChatGPT implementation features intelligent routing between multiple GPT models depending on task complexity. Simple queries receive near-instant responses from faster models, while complex reasoning, mathematical problems, or coding tasks automatically engage deeper “thinking” models that spend more time analyzing the problem before generating solutions. This hybrid approach balances speed and capability, providing optimal performance across diverse use cases.

Core Technologies

Large Language Models (GPT Series)
ChatGPT is powered by OpenAI’s GPT models, including GPT-3.5, GPT-4, GPT-4o, and the latest GPT-5 series. These transformer-based neural networks are trained on vast datasets encompassing books, websites, code repositories, and diverse text sources, enabling broad knowledge and sophisticated language understanding.

Intelligent Model Routing
The system automatically selects the most appropriate model variant for each query. GPT-5.2 Instant handles straightforward information retrieval and writing, GPT-5.2 Thinking tackles complex coding and analysis, while GPT-5.2 Pro provides maximum accuracy for difficult professional tasks.

Multimodal Capabilities
ChatGPT processes and generates multiple content types including text, code, images (via DALL-E integration), and document analysis. Users can upload PDFs, images, spreadsheets, and other files for analysis, summarization, or data extraction.

Conversation Memory
ChatGPT maintains context throughout conversations, remembering previous exchanges within a session and, with memory features enabled, across multiple sessions. This enables coherent multi-turn dialogues and personalized assistance over time.

Real-Time Information Access
With web browsing enabled, ChatGPT can search the internet for current information, access recent news, lookup facts, and verify data beyond its training cutoff, ensuring responses remain accurate and up-to-date.

Custom Instructions
Users can set persistent preferences guiding ChatGPT’s behavior, response style, level of detail, and focus areas, creating personalized experiences tailored to specific needs and use cases.

How ChatGPT Works

User Input Processing
When users submit prompts, ChatGPT tokenizes the input into smaller units, creating numerical representations that capture semantic meaning and relationships between words.

Context Integration
The model considers the full conversation history, user preferences, and custom instructions to understand intent and maintain coherent dialogue across multiple exchanges.

Model Selection and Routing
ChatGPT’s orchestration layer evaluates query complexity and automatically routes requests to the most appropriate GPT variant—Instant for speed, Thinking for depth, or Pro for maximum accuracy.

Response Generation
Selected models process the augmented prompt through multiple transformer layers, using attention mechanisms to identify relevant patterns and relationships. The model generates responses token by token, predicting the most probable next word based on context.

Quality Assurance
Responses undergo filtering to remove potentially harmful content, verify factual consistency when possible, and ensure alignment with OpenAI’s usage policies and ethical guidelines.

Output Delivery
Generated responses are presented to users with appropriate formatting, including markdown for structured content, code blocks for programming examples, and citations when web browsing retrieves external information.

Limitations and Considerations

Knowledge Cutoff
Training data has a cutoff date (currently January 2025), meaning ChatGPT lacks knowledge of events occurring after this point without web browsing enabled.

Potential Inaccuracies
ChatGPT may generate plausible-sounding but factually incorrect information, particularly for obscure topics, recent events, or highly specialized domains requiring verification.

No Real-Time Awareness
Without web browsing, the system cannot access current information, stock prices, weather, news, or any real-time data not present in its training dataset.

Context Length Limits
Conversations have finite context windows, and extremely long documents or extended dialogues may exceed these limits, requiring summarization or chunking.

Reasoning Limitations
While improved in GPT-5 series, complex mathematical reasoning, multi-step logical problems, and certain abstract reasoning tasks may still produce errors.

Lack of True Understanding
ChatGPT processes statistical patterns rather than possessing genuine comprehension, consciousness, or understanding of meaning, truth, or real-world cause and effect.

Bias and Safety
Training data biases may influence responses, and despite safety measures, inappropriate content occasionally emerges requiring ongoing monitoring and improvement.

No Persistent External Actions
ChatGPT cannot directly execute actions in external systems, send emails, make purchases, or modify files without user intervention and appropriate integrations.

Best Practices and Tips

Prompt Engineering Techniques
Structure prompts with clear roles, tasks, context, format, and examples. Use “Act as…” to define perspective, provide relevant background information, specify desired output format (bullet points, table, code), and include examples demonstrating expected results.

Iterative Refinement
Start with basic prompts and progressively add detail based on initial responses. Request clarification when outputs miss expectations, ask follow-up questions to deepen understanding, and build on previous exchanges within conversations.

Context Management
Provide necessary background information without overwhelming with irrelevant details. Reference previous parts of conversation when building on earlier topics, summarize key points for complex multi-turn dialogues, and restart conversations when context becomes unwieldy.

Task Decomposition
Break complex tasks into smaller, manageable steps. Have ChatGPT outline approach before generating detailed content, process large documents in sections rather than overwhelming context window, and verify each step before proceeding to next phase.

Quality Assurance
Verify factual claims in critical contexts through external sources. Request citations and sources when possible, cross-check calculations and technical details, test generated code thoroughly before production use, and maintain skepticism about confident-sounding but unverified claims.

Efficiency Optimization
Save effective prompts as templates for recurring tasks. Use custom GPTs for specialized, repeated workflows, leverage keyboard shortcuts and voice input for faster interaction, organize conversations with clear naming and folders, and establish systematic approaches to common use cases.

Frequently Asked Questions

Can ChatGPT access the internet?
Yes, with web browsing enabled (Plus and higher plans), ChatGPT can search and retrieve current information from the internet.

Is ChatGPT data secure?
Conversations are encrypted, and users can disable training data usage. Enterprise plans offer enhanced security including SSO, data residency controls, and compliance certifications.

Can I use ChatGPT commercially?
Yes, paid plan users can use ChatGPT output for commercial purposes, though terms of service prohibit certain high-risk applications and require appropriate attribution.

Does ChatGPT remember conversations?
Within a session, yes. Across sessions, memory features can be enabled to maintain context and preferences over time, or disabled for privacy.

What languages does ChatGPT support?
ChatGPT supports dozens of languages including English, Spanish, French, German, Chinese, Japanese, Arabic, and many more, though performance varies by language.

Can ChatGPT write and execute code?
Yes, ChatGPT can write code in multiple programming languages and, with Advanced Data Analysis enabled, execute Python code to process data and generate visualizations.

How does ChatGPT compare to search engines?
ChatGPT provides synthesized, conversational responses and can reason about information, while search engines return links to source documents. ChatGPT with web browsing combines both approaches.
